For my web site I am just creating some 360 degree dynamic images from the panoramic views I rendered with IRender for a particular project. I used an earlier version of Panoweaver to do this before and all was fine and straightforward. I just bought the newer version of Panoweaver as the one I used before was work based. This version is asking me questions about the type of original image for which I do not know the answer – see screen save attached……

I have attached one IRender panoramic image as a reference. Which of the options on the Panoweaver dialogue should I use? Which of these image types best describes the IRender panoramic output?

I downloaded PanoWeaver 9.2 Standard in trial mode.

I selected "Import Panoramic Image" from the File Menu and loaded your image.

I then selected "Publish Panoramic Image" from the Tools Menu and saved it.

 (This is an image from the Panorama. If I had purchased PanoWeaver it wouldn't have the watermarks in it)

It created a HTML Panoramic image in a folder which you can see here.
